what would be the best cam for a DD with the heads and manifold?
I think it depends on what your going for. I have a 228/230 112 and love it. It has some lope and doesn't lose the power in the lower RPM range like most of the larger cams do. GKE suggested a 224/228 114 which is the largest cam us in CA can use and still pass smog. I would talk to your tuner and tell them what your goals are and how you plan on driving the car, and then make a decision.
